Autohaven is a big nono. Usually autohavens are actually pallethavens with many double safe pallets.
No, open, like, super open.
Shelter Woods, Rotten Fields.
That being said, Shelter Woods has few pallets, but most of the time they are as safe as can be and Survivors are guaranteed to run there.
Blood Lodge is an exception because it has nothing but pallets.
Torment Creek can have a LOT of them.
Thompson House has so much I quit that map twice the previous season.
Rancid Abbatoir - don't even get me started.
Azarov's Resting Place CAN have relatively few, but thats's very unlikely.
Wretched Shop is your average pallet breaking simulator.
I'd say Shelter Woods and RF should have arguably the smallest numbers.
Sometimes Lery can go full out war on you and spawn a whole lot of abusable windows/double safe pallets, sometimes it doesn't
Same for Haddonfield, a couple of safe pallets here and there or full out war one big loop map.
Swamps are just designed as a semi-loophole, semi-99%hidingspotsforClaudettes
And the second Swamp map can mess your hooks up pretty badly.
tl;dr Rotten Fields/Shelter Wood. Or newer maps with better RNG, but god forbid if you get the worst RNG there.
Badham is an exception. Don't go to Badham. Just don't .
